WebThree alleles for the same gene control the inheritance of ABO blood types, by determining which antigens will be expressed on the surface of red blood cells. The resulting four blood types are A, B, AB and O. Select all of the true statements about the inheritance of human blood types. - Has multiple alleles. WebMendel's law of independent assortment states that the alleles of two (or more) different genes get sorted into gametes independently of one another. In other words, the allele a gamete receives for one gene does not influence the allele received for another gene. Homozygous genes contain the same type of alleles while heterozygous genes are made up of two different types of alleles. Codominance is a type of genetic inheritance wherein the alleles are neither dominant nor recessive. Thus, both alleles are expressed in a heterozygous gene.

WebFeb 7, 2024 · An organism with two different alleles at a gene locus (one dominant and one recessive - Aa) has a heterozygous genotype. Homozygous genotype signifies the presence of two identical alleles (both normal or identically mutated - AA or aa ). Imagine that … Each individual has two copies of a given gene, such as the gene for seed color … For instance, if you had a pea plant heterozygous for a seed shape gene … the scanner roomWebFemales have two X chromosomes (XX), while males have one X chromosome and one Y chromosome (XY). This means females have two alleles for X-linked genes while males only have one.
